About The Position

The Employee Success Manager (ESM) is a strategic people leader responsible for maximizing team performance, driving talent retention, and aligning professional development with business objectives. This role provides direct people and career leadership to technical staff, partnering closely with Technical Leads who own the technical direction and architecture. The ESM plays a critical role in driving accountability and shaping a high-performing, people-first culture within REDspace. Responsibilities

  • Execute a structured 1:1 meeting cadence with assigned technical staff to align individual career velocity with REDspace’s project pipeline and technical delivery goals.
  • Proactively identify high-potential talent and design strategic succession, growth, and internal mobility paths to retain critical skills.
  • Direct and manage the onboarding lifecycle of new hires, ensuring rapid time-to-productivity and alignment with company culture.
  • Partner with HR to drive the recruitment process when required, conducting strategic pre-screens and participating in panel interviews.
  • Lead the end-to-end performance review process; synthesize feedback from Technical Leads, Project Managers, and clients to deliver objective, high-impact annual evaluations.
  • Independently manage and execute Performance Improvement Plans (PIPs), addressing underperformance decisively and in alignment with organizational standards.
  • Partner with the Resourcing and Director teams to optimize talent allocation, ensuring direct reports are strategically placed on projects to maximize both client impact and employee growth.
  • Serve as the functional champion for internal performance tools (e.g., Small Improvements), leveraging data, OKRs, and 360 reporting to deliver actionable people insights to executive leadership.
  • Act as the primary escalation point for employee relations, workload imbalances, and morale issues—resolving conflicts before they impact project delivery.
  • Partner with HR to manage organizational risk while driving a high-performance, delivery-focused culture.
  • Manage team capacity and operational resourcing (including PTO approvals and leave management), balancing employee well-being with active project delivery needs.
